Last official estimated population of Sanders County was 11,395 (year 2014)[1]. This was 0.004% of total US population and 1.1% of total Montana state population. Area of Sanders County is 2,790.0 mi² (=7226 km²), in this year population density was 4.08 p/mi². If population growth rate would be same as in period 2010-2014 (-0.04%/yr), Sanders County population in 2025 would be 11,346 [0].
